[**Kilimanjaro Packing List**](https://www.alaitolsafari.com/kilimanjaro-trekking-essential-packing-list) **Gears You Need to Bring** You are responsible for bringing personal gear and equipment. Below is a gear list you need to bring on your climb. **Item Quantity(ies)** * Head light/ torch1 pc, * Balaclava1 pc * Sunglass1 pc * Warm Hat1 pc * Sun Hat1 Pc * Base Layer2 pcs * Top Fleece2 pcs * Warm Hat1 pc * Warm Jackect1 pc * Poncho1 pc * Long Underwear2 pcs * Ski Pant1 pc * Rain Pant1 pc * Trekking Pant1 pc * Thin Socks2 pcs * Thick Socks3 pcs * Mountain Boots1 pc * Tennis Shoe1 pc * Gators1 pair * Warm Gloves1 pair * Ski Gloves2 pairs * Duffel Bag / Rucksack1 pc * Day Pack1 pc * Scarf1 pc * Walking Poles1 pair **Highlights** * Climb with confidence: Alaitol Safari has been leading treks up Kilimanjaro for more than 7 years and boasts a successful summit rate of 98 percent. * Superior, top-of-the-line camping gear and safety equipment, owned and maintained by Alaitol’s. * Quality assured: Alaitol directly employs all chefs, porters, and guides (who are all certified Wilderness First Responders). * Stay in the largest and most comfortable sleeping tents on the mountain, with private toilet facilities. * Carry only a daypack, as porters transport your luggage and equipment throughout the climb and descent. **Climb Kilimanjaro with Alaitol:**With a successful summit rate of 98 percent (compared to the 60-70 percent average), Alaitol’s Mount Kilimanjaro expeditions give you an outstanding chance of reaching ‘the roof of Africa’. Our experienced climbing team oversees every factor that contributes to a successful climb **Guides & porters:**Every Alaitol guide is a certified Wilderness First Responder, trained in mountain craft, natural history, and ecological awareness. Our guides are also trained in first aid and are fluent in English, and most have completed over 200 summits. A founding member of the Kilimanjaro Porter Assistance Project and a proud Partner for Responsible Travel with the International Mountain Explorers Connection, Alaitol’s is an advocate for the welfare of our team of porters. Their hard work and dedication are what make every Alaitol’s trek possible. **Comforts on the mountain:**Summiting Mount Kilimanjaro comes easier to those who are well-rested – and Alaitol campsites are famous for their comforts. Our customised sleeping tents are the largest and most luxurious on the mountain, designed for two people with raised camp beds and tall ceiling heights. Solar-lit dining tents with comfortable tables and chairs allow you to relax out of the elements and rejuvenate during the trek. Hygienic private toilets are also exclusively available to Alaitol trekkers. **Safety on the mountain:**Alaitol’s climbs use the finest climbing and camping apparatus, safety equipment, and communications network. On every climb, we supply and carry all safety and emergency equipment, including emergency oxygen, a portable altitude chamber, a defibrillator, pulse oximeters, a stretcher, an extensive first aid kit, and three means of communication (mobile phone, two-way radio, and satellite phone). **Food & nutrition:**Another key element to conquering Kilimanjaro is to maintain proper nutrition throughout your entire trek. Every meal is designed to provide the fuel you need to reach the summit. Unlike many other companies, Alaitol provides fresh food throughout the entire trek, including abundant snacks between meals as well as unlimited, purified water. Special diets can also be accommodated. **Acclimatisation:**While most trekkers spend a total of five days on the mountain, we schedule seven days (six nights) to allow more time for premium altitude acclimatisation, contributing to Alaitol’s successful summit rate of 98 percent. **Sustainable Treks:**Alaitol leaves no trace on the mountain and takes pride in operating green campsites. Every Alaitol camp is completely portable with no fixed ground structures or plumbing, and we remove all waste and rubbish from our treks. **\* Please contact us for your child quote.
